What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Bristol to Edinburgh?

The average price of all flights from Bristol to Edinburgh cl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to Edinburgh on a Monday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Friday is the most expensive day to fly from Bristol to Edinburgh.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Thursday and avoiding Sundays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Bristol to Edinburgh?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Bristol to Edinburgh,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Bristol to Edinburgh is March, where tickets cost £79 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and February, where the average cost of tickets is £111 and £102 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Bristol to Edinburgh?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Bristol to Edinburgh,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Bristol to Edinburgh, you should book around 3 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 88 days before departure.

Which airlines provide the cheapest flights from Bristol to Edinburgh?

The cheapest price for the route for each airline clicked by KAYAK users in the last 72 hours.
In the last 72 hours, the cheapest one-way ticket from Bristol to Edinburgh found on KAYAK was with easyJet for £30. easyJet proposed a return connection from £55 and Aer Lingus from £314.

Which airlines fly direct between Bristol and Edinburgh?

Airline and price data is aggregated from results in KAYAK’s search results from the last 2 weeks for flights from Bristol to Edinburgh.
There is just one airline that flies from Bristol to Edinburgh direct and that is easyJet. The best one-way deal found from easyJet for the route is £46.

How many flights are there between Bristol and Edinburgh per day?

Each day, there are between 2 and 5 nonstop flights that take off from Bristol and land in Edinburgh, with an average flight time of 1h 15m. The most common departure time is 07:00 and most flights take off in the morning. Each week, there are 28 flights. The most frequent day of departure is Friday, when 18% of all weekly flights depart. The fewest flights depart on a Saturday.

Which cabin class options are there for flights between Bristol and Edinburgh?

The average price of flights for each cabin class for the route found by users searching on KAYAK over the last 2 weeks.
There is only one cabin class option available for the route, which is Economy. Perform a search on KAYAK to find the latest prices and availability for all cabin fares, which differ across airlines.

How long does a flight from Bristol to Edinburgh take?

The average direct flight takes 1h 15m, covering a distance of 316 miles.

What’s the earliest departure time from Bristol to Edinburgh?

Early birds can take the earliest flight from Bristol at 07:00 and will be landing in Edinburgh at 08:15.

What’s the latest departure time from Bristol to Edinburgh?

If you prefer to fly at night, the latest flight from Bristol to Edinburgh jets off at 22:00 and lands at 23:15.

FAQs for booking flights from Bristol to Edinburgh

  • Is there a car-hire service at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port?

    If you prefer having your own personal transport, you can arrange a pick-up or drop-off by the Car Hire Centre at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port. Once you find the directions to the Multi-Story Car Pak, just follow the walkway to the centre. Many well-known providers offer car hire, including Europcar, Enterprise and AVIS.

  • What are the public transport options from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port?

    Avanti and Transpennine Express are among a handful of mainline rail providers operating service to Edinburgh Waverley, the city’s central terminal. You can also get tram transport multiple times per hour to other central locations like Haymarket and York Place.

  • Are there any hotels located at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port?

    Unfortunately, you won’t find any accommodation on the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port premises, but if you’re seeking an affordable place to sleep, there are a few hotels right on its doorstep. Hampton by Hilton is a short walk away, and the free airport shuttle only takes two minutes to arrive at Doubletree by Hilton Edinburgh Airport. Moxy Edinburgh Airport is another option to consider.

  • What other cities can I get to from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port?

    As Scotland’s first city, Edinburgh offers a comprehensive transport network by air, land and sea. You can travel by road, rail or bus west to Glasgow and north to Stirling, Dundee, or Perth. Inverness is the most northern city in the UK, and it only takes about 3h 30min to drive there from Edinburgh.

Top tips for finding a cheap flight from Bristol to Edinburgh

  • Looking for a cheap flight from Bristol to Edinburgh? 25% of our users found flights on this route for £41 or less one-way and £78 or less round-trip.
  • The route from Bristol Airport (BRS) to Edinburgh Turnhouse Airport (EDI) is less frequent than some routes, but you can still get direct and indirect services from a few major airlines. EasyJet provides a small number of direct flights, while Ryanair and KLM each have a few requiring stopovers in Dublin and Amsterdam, respectively.
  • If you’re unfamiliar with the Bristol area, finding the most convenient transport to the airport could be a challenge. The A1 Bristol Flyer runs express to and from Bristol Temple Meads terminal in the city centre approximately three times per hour, 24 hours a day. The station is also a hub for the regional intercity rail service, just in case you’re coming in from a nearby location.
  • Familiar or not, finding a nice place to relax before your flight departs is never a bad idea. Aspire Lounge (Mezzanine, Departures Lounge) offers complimentary beverages, snacks and more with just enough laid-back atmosphere to make you feel welcome. AspirePlus Lounge, on the other hand, is an executive experience for adults located near Cabin Bar.
  • Families travelling to Edinburgh with young kids should know that Bristol Airport provides Short Stay and Long Stay parking options when you have to park and fly. In addition, you'll find baby changing facilities throughout the terminal, another travel-related essential to enhance your airport experience.
  • A Fast Track pass offers convenience even if you’re not flying with kids in tow. Purchasing a pass allows you to eliminate the bother of long queues and distractions by providing a dedicated line with little wait time. You can buy them online when you book your flight or buy one from a kiosk at the airport upon arrival.
